§ 31A-25-202 — Application for license.

(1)(1)(a) An application for a license as a third party administrator shall be:
(1)(a)(i) made to the commissioner on forms and in a manner the commissioner prescribes; and
(1)(a)(ii) accompanied by the applicable fee, which is not refundable if the application is denied.
(1)(b) The application for a license as a third party administrator shall:
(1)(b)(i) state the applicant's:
(1)(b)(i)(A) Social Security number; or
(1)(b)(i)(B) federal employer identification number;
(1)(b)(ii) provide information about:
(1)(b)(ii)(A) the applicant's identity;
(1)(b)(ii)(B) the applicant's personal history, experience, education, and business record;
(1)(b)(ii)(C) if the applicant is a natural person, whether the applicant is 18 years of age or older; and
